Angie Nixon projected to win Florida Democratic Senate primary

In a development that will shape Florida’s federal representation, the Associated Press projects former state Rep. Angie Nixon as the winner of the Democratic primary for the U.S. Senate held on Tuesday, Aug. 18. Nixon’s projected victory positions her to face incumbent Republican Sen. Ashley Moody in the general election on Nov. 3.

Primary results and candidates

The contested Democratic primary featured two main candidates: Angie Nixon, a former member of the Florida House of Representatives, and Alexander Vindman, a former national security official. While both candidates campaigned across the state, Nixon’s long‑standing ties to Florida’s legislative process and her focus on local concerns such as education, health care access, and economic opportunity resonated with Democratic voters.

Election analysts noted that Nixon’s name recognition, especially in central and northern Florida, gave her a decisive edge. Vindman, despite his national profile, struggled to gain traction in a crowded field and ultimately fell short of the projected vote threshold.
